Default garmin 178c question

helped a friend install a new lowrance gps/sounder combo. he gave me his old 178c, but he cut the plug to remove it(grrrrrr). i have a power plug for my 2010c that will work & power up, but there is no place for the transducer to plug in, does it take a special plug that combines thew two?

I have a 178C as well and the plug into the unit does split into to separate cords. One to the power source and the other to the transducer. Not really sure of your question though. I will have mine at my house tomorrow.

thanks tartuffe, that's what i meant, the unit only has one plug in on the back, was not sure where the transducer went. on my other garmin's they needed a black box the transducer went to, then to the power cord. i'm guessing no black box, just straight to the split cord.
